Still fascinating today

The story is timeless and still holds your attention today. I was amazed as to how modern the film itself is. Probably the best known of G.W. Pabst’s works. Being a film from the silent era gives this film a collector’s value, yet five minutes into viewing and you do not realize it is silent. Lulu (Louise Brooks), an amoral entertainer in 1928 Berlin, is having fun taking men for all they have and snubbing those who may care for her. After moving to London, she is still in the habit of entertaining men at her place. She is about to open Pandora’s Box, as she has no idea who she has lured up to her place. If you are looking for an ending with a moral statement, you will be disappointed, as it is more of a Quid pro quo. If it is not already included in the media you picked for this film, there is an available separate documentary produced in 1998 for Turner Classic Movies called Louise Brooks - Looking for Lulu, narrated by Shirley MacLaine, which is almost as interesting as this film.
